DISPLAY DEVICE
A display device for transmitting, over a general purpose data network, graphical data to a remote device, the display device comprising a framebuffer memory for storing the graphical data; and a network interface for maintaining two-way network transmission of graphical data to and from the display device and operable to read or write to the framebuffer memory; wherein the network interface transmits the contents of the framebuffer memory to at least one remote device over the network.
